Condition: Excellent vintage condition with minimal signs of wear. No holes, tears, or stains. About Avoca Woollen Mills: Founded in 1723, Avoca is one of the oldest working mills in Ireland. The company became globally known for its handwoven textiles, especially colorful throws, scarves, and garments made from pure new wool. Garments like this were typically produced from the 1960s–1990s, with this label style and tag (plus the medium woven wool stripes) suggesting 1980s.
